Citations
2 citations on file for this inspection.
1926.1053 B01
- Issued
- Dec 2, 2024
- Penalty
- Initial $3,042 · Current $2,000 Reduced
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.1053(b)(1): Portable ladders were used for access to an upper landing surface, the ladder side rails did not extend at least 3 feet above the upper landing surface to which the ladder is used to gain access: A) 12 Boxwood Lane, Rye - NY: An employee was exposed to fall hazards of approximately 13- feet while using an extension ladder to access a roof. The extension ladder that was used, did not extend at least 3 feet above the landing, on or about, October 18th, 2024.

1926.501 B13
- Issued
- Dec 2, 2024
- Penalty
- Initial $9,126 · Current $6,280 Reduced
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13):"Residential construction." Each employee eng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els were not protected by guardrail systems, safety net systems, or personal fall arrest system, nor were employee(s) provided with an alternative fall protection measure under another provision of paragraph 1926.501 (b). A) 12 Boxwood Lane, Rye - NY: An employee was exposed to fall hazards of approximately 13-feet while engaged in roofing work on a residential structure. The employee was not protected by any type of fall protection system, on or about, October 18th, 2024. REPEAT INFO: Jaro Danc, LLC. was previously cited for a violation of this occupational safety and health standard or its equivalent standard 29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13), which was contained in OSHA inspection number 1655385, citation number 1, item number 1 and was affirmed as a final order on September 30th, 2024, with respect to a workplace located at 12 Boxwood Lane, Rye - NY.
